How to filter data in Google Sheets?
Filtering data in Google Sheets is a useful way to quickly find and analyze specific information in a spreadsheet. Here is a step-by-step guide to filtering data in Google Sheets:
- Select the range of cells you want to filter.
- Click on the “Data” tab in the menu bar.
- Choose “Create a filter” from the drop-down menu.
- Filter options will appear at the top of each column. Click the drop-down arrow for the column you want to filter.
- Select the filter criteria you want to use.
- Repeat steps 4 and 5 for each column you want to filter.
- To remove a filter, click the “Filter” button at the top of the sheet and select “Turn off filter.”
Filtering data in Google Sheets can save you time and help you better understand your data. Experiment with different filters to find the information you need.
